Svartåsflotjärnarna
Character of the water
Svartåsflotjärnarna lies in central Sweden — a mesotrophic stratified lake. In summer a thermocline settles around 7 m and splits the lake into two worlds.

Permits & rules
Fishing permit required — Svartåsflotjärnarna FVOF. Day permit ~140 kr · annual permit ~700 kr.
- Zander: minimum size 45 cm · protected during the spawn (Apr–May).
- Pike: keep at most one over 75 cm per day.
- Handheld tackle only. Respect the protected zones at the inlets and outlets.
